When Sera Watkins and her family arrive at their summer house on Cape Cod, she has one goal in mind- protect her heart from the boy who broke it, her next-door neighbor, Luke Tisdale. The problem is, Luke still has a piece of her heart-literally. When Sera received a new heart as a baby, the healthy valves of her old heart were given to Luke. Forever bonded, Luke and Sera grew up together spending sun-soaked days swimming at their secret beach and painting at art camp. Then, two summers ago, their friendship almost turned into something more. Key word- almost. Because one fateful night, everything changed. Sera's health took a turn for the worse. A family secret sent Luke spiraling. And they weren't there for each other when it mattered the most. Now Sera is ready for a fresh start, which means no more pining over the boy next door. But Luke has grown up a lot since she last saw him, and the chemistry she felt two summers ago? It's still there. Sera isn't sure she's brave enough to risk it all again, but when she gets some difficult news, she realizes there's no time to waste.
